Where is Museum of Sugar and Chocolate Arts?

Cordes-sur-Ciel is home to Museum of Sugar and Chocolate Arts. Cordes-sur-Ciel is a budget-friendly city known for its selection of restaurants. If you want to find things to do in the area, you might want to stop in and see Aigueleze Golf Club and Chateau de Najac.
